Radiation Transport Through Super-Eddington Stellar Winds

Solar and Stellar Astrophysics 2018-06-05 v1

Abstract

We present results of simulations to assess the feasibility of modeling outflows from massive stars using the Los Alamos 3-D radiation hydrodynamics code Cassio developed for inertial confinement fusion (ICF) applications. We find that a 1-D stellar envelope simulation relaxes into hydrostatic equilibrium using computing resources that would make the simulation tractable in 2-D. We summarize next steps to include more physics fidelity and model the response to a large and abrupt energy deposition at the base of the envelope.
